What does the superintendent do . This was second grade. They will answer anything. Every hand in the room went up. Write down in front was this little guy named michael. He was trying to follow the rules. He is just trying to get called on. He jumps up and says, i know. The teacher says, all right what does the superintendent do . That is the guy in charge of super nintendo. [laughter] it sounded like a better job. This brilliant teacher says, that was a creative interpretation of the language, but actually the superintendent is the leader of the schools. Does anybody know a leader does what a leader does . There was a little girl sitting in the back. As far back as he possibly could. She had her hand raised so high. The teacher called on her. The teacher says, ok what does a leader do . She looks at me and says, a leader is someone who goes out and changes being to make things better changes things to make things better.
